Responsible for performing and assisting with cardiac diagnostic testing procedures.

Responsibilities
- 1. Prepares patient and equipment for all stress testing procedures.
- 1.1 1 Checks Tech worklist for patient arrival and insures correct physician order and ordering codes are in Epic. Informs front desk staff, nurse or supervisor before patient is brought back for test/procedure if order or codes are not correct.
- 2. Apply 24 hour Holter monitors and event monitors on patients. Download returned holter monitors into system.
- 2.1 Checks Tech worklist for patient arrival and insures correct physician order and ordering codes are in Epic. Informs front desk staff, nurse or supervisor before patient is brought back for test/procedure if order or codes are not correct
- 3. Performs PVRs.
- 3.1 Verifies physician order on Tech worklist in Epic. Completes Epic tech worklist process. Informs front desk staff, nurse or supervisor before patient is brought back for test/procedure if order is not correct.
- 4. Performs administrative and other duties as assigned.
- 4.1 Completes pre-testing Covid checks to ensure patients have Covid test order, are scheduled for the Covid test and have completed test before exercise stress testing procedures. Documents in note on tech work list.
Qualifications
EDUCATION High school diploma or equivalent. Medical Assistant Certification EXPERIENCE Minimum two years experience in a hospital or medical office setting; preferably Cardiology. LICENSURE Certified medical assistant, certified nurse assistant or patient care technician. PHYSICAL DEMAND Requires extended periods of sitting, walking and standing. Moderate unassisted lifting to 30 lbs.
